The Margaret Lake Trail is a bit of a hidden gem, and the 5.5-mile journey will leave you breathless in more ways than one.
Margaret Lake Trail is located in the Mount Baker Snoqualmie National Forest near the town of Easton.
Charles Calvert / alltrails.com To reach it, take I-90 E (from Seattle) or W to Exit 54. Take a left off the interstate, a right on FSR 4832, and hang a left on on FSR 4934, which takes you to a parking area.

Eventually, you’ll come to the beautiful Margaret Lake.
Krist Lam / alltrails.com The lake is a wonderful place to relax and enjoy a refreshing swim (weather permitting) or have a picnic lunch on the banks.
This trail is at its best from June-September, so you still have time this summer to make it happen.
